Subject: Re: [PATCH net-next 1/2] virtio_net: Introduce VIRTIO_NET_F_MASTER feature bit




On 1/3/2018 9:43 AM, Michael S. Tsirkin wrote:
On Tue, Jan 02, 2018 at 04:35:37PM -0800, Sridhar Samudrala wrote:
This feature bit can be used by hypervisor to indicate virtio_net device to
act as a master for a directly attached passthru device with the same MAC
address.

Well the virtio hardware doesn't really know whether it's a master or
the slave of a bond. In fact quite possibly down the road we'll add a
virtual device on top as others seem to want to do - that other one will
be the master then.

And we do nothing do check it's a VF.

So maybe a better name would be

#define VIRTIO_NET_F_BACKUP	62	/* Act as backup for another device with the same MAC */
Yes. BACKUP  does make more sense as virtio is only used as a BACKUP datapath when the other
device is unplugged.
